Ujjain : There seems to be no end to increase in theft incidents in the city. Though the local police have intensified patrolling to keep a check on such incidents, these are taking place at regular intervals. Over 10 theft incidents had been reported in city only during the past one month.
In the latest incident, some unidentified thieves broke into a house in the Nagehsvar Dham Colony area under Chimanganj Mandi police circle in broad daylight and decamped with cash and gold jewelry worth 2 lakhs on Monday. The theft took place in the house of Omkarlal, who is a teacher by profession. In his complaint to the police, Omkarlal said the theft took place after he left his house for attending a marriage function organized at Makdon.
When he returned to my house in the evening, he found the locks of doors of the rooms broken. He said the thieves stole Rs 200000 in cash and gold jewelry from his house. He informed the police about the incident. A police team, of Chimanganj Mandi police station, reached the spot and initiated investigation. The rising incidents of theft have spread a feeling of insecurity among the residents. The police have failed to crack most of the cases. The failure of the police in preventing theft incidents has raised a question mark over the functioning of the Police Department.
